SHOW NEWS: ICTS to present latest version of InnerEye threat detection system at Passenger Terminal EXPO

LinkedIn +

Going through airport security can be quite a trying experience. With the many rules applying to baggage, and the resultant seemingly endless queue, getting screened before a flight is time-consuming.

To streamline airport security, aviation security specialist ICTS Europe will launch the latest version of its InnerEye threat detection solution at Passenger Terminal EXPO 2018.

Designed to augment performance among security screening staff, InnerEye is a headset with EEG capabilities that interprets x-ray images in real time by analyzing the screener’s brainwaves.

The new generation InnerEye to be presented at the EXPO includes new artificial intelligence features and enhanced computer vision capabilities to further boost screening speed and level of accuracy.

This truly revolutionary interface allows a single screener to analyze thousands of images per hour, while maintaining high detection levels and low false alarm rates, thereby making the entire security process simultaneously more accurate and efficient.

InnerEye is easily integrated with any standard x-ray machine and requires no changes to the airport’s existing HBS or central checkpoint infrastructure.

Increased security through increased awareness ICTS also notes that public venues such as airports and other transport hubs are becoming increasingly vulnerable to terrorist attack. To help counter this risk, ICTS has developed Aware – a new training app designed to introduce non-security staff to the principles of security, so that they may become active participants in the effort to keep the airport safe.

Using interactive methods, Aware can help your airport capitalize on staff already working there by guiding them on how to take notice of, and report on, suspicious signs relating to people, objects, vehicles or facilities.

Aware can be easily accessed on the employee’s mobile phone, or on any other device such as a PC or tablet. To find out more visit ICTS Europe on stand 510.
